Almost Candy Bars

1 devils food cake mix (I had Pillsbury)
1 stick butter
1 cup butterscotch chips
1 cup chocolate chips
1 cup sweetened coconut flakes
1 cup chopped nuts (I had pecans)
1 14oz can sweetened condensed milk

With fork or pastry blender, cut butter into cake mix until crumbly. Press into a 9x13 pan. Layer all the ingredients in order, pouring the condensed milk last. Bake at 350 for 20-minutes until lightly browned. Cool completely and then cut into bars.
